## Runbook: Consentry banner rollout

Before approving the rollout branch, verify the staged configuration carefully. The Consentry banner service reads region rules from `rules/regions.yaml`, and any mismatch between the staged ruleset and the published policy version will block the canary. Confirm the `.env` file on the rollout host includes the policy-sync toggle and the correct upstream hostname. The service also signs each consent receipt, so the signing credential must be present; add this line next:

vault entry, kagep-yajeg: COURIER_KEY5=da097

Finance Review — Retiring the Cobblestone Line

Short version for sales leads: the Cobblestone accessories line is heading for retirement at the end of Q3. Revenue has been sliding for five straight quarters, and the tooling refresh needed to keep it alive just doesn't pencil out. We'll run a clearance push through the Harlock distributor network and protect key accounts with swap offers into the Fenwick range. Commissions on clearance stay at standard rates. What this means strategically is spelled out in the note below.

board note of kagep-yahig: Only 9 of the 120 pilot accounts renewed Quenix, so a churn review is set for April 1.

## Getting Started: Ladleworks Scaling Engine

Welcome, plugin authors. The Ladleworks recipe-scaling calculator exposes a single entry point: you receive a normalized ingredient list and a target yield, and return scaled quantities. Rounding rules are applied by the core after your plugin runs, so don't round yourself. Unit conversions must go through the provided conversion table; hardcoded factors will fail review. Once your manifest validates, request sandbox credentials from the plugin intake team at the address below.

alerts address for kajog-tadup: druox@plorvanet.internal